SUPEROBJECT DELPHI ПРИМЕРЫ

SuperObject - это библиотека для работы с JSON в Delphi. С ее помощью можно легко создавать, изменять и парсить JSON-данные, что делает работу с этим форматом простой и удобной. Давайте рассмотрим несколько примеров использования SuperObject в Delphi.

Пример № 1: Создание JSON-объекта

var so: ISuperObject;begin so := TSuperObject.Create; so.S['name'] := 'John'; so.I['age'] := 30;end;

Пример № 2: Работа с JSON-массивом

var so: ISuperObject;begin so := TSuperObject.Create(stArray); so.AsArray.Add('John'); so.AsArray.Add(30);end;

Пример № 3: Парсинг JSON-строки

var s: string; so: ISuperObject;begin s := '{"name": "John", "age": 30}'; so := SO(s);end;

Пример № 4: Преобразование JSON-объекта в строку

var so: ISuperObject; s: string;begin so := TSuperObject.Create; so.S['name'] := 'John'; so.I['age'] := 30; s := so.AsJSon;end;

Пример № 5: Обход JSON-дерева

var so: ISuperObject; it: TSuperObjectIter;begin so := SO('{"name": "John", "age": 30}'); if Assigned(so) then begin if so.IsType(stObject) then begin SuperObject.ObjectFindFirst(so.O, it); while SuperObject.ObjectFindNext(it) do begin // Обработка пары "ключ-значение" end; end; end;end;

Создание базы данных сотрудники в Delphi - Урок 1 (Подключение базы данных)

Программирование в Delphi Урок 3 2 Работа с текстом, строковые функции Length, Pos и другие

Построение графиков функции в Delphi часть 1

Всё о Delphi \u0026 Pascal / Из музыканта в программисты / Интервью с Delphi Developer

Как сделать нейросеть в Delphi

Создание теста на Delphi кратко и по теме

Зачем учиться программировать на Delphi

Delphi мертв?

#11 Программирование в Delphi. ООП. Классы

Вебинар \

Реклама
Новое
Реклама